Navigating Cybersecurity Risks in Building Management Systems
Modern property automation platforms (BMS) offer unprecedented efficiency and performance savings, but simultaneously introduce significant IT click here security challenges. These interconnected platforms are increasingly targeted by malicious actors seeking to disrupt services or exfiltrate sensitive data. Protecting these vital systems requires a holistic approach, encompassing frequent vulnerability assessments, robust access controls, and diligent staff education. Failure to address these exposures can result in disruptions, including financial losses. Consider these crucial steps:
Apply strong authentication protocols.
Maintain software and devices regularly.
Segment the BMS system from other corporate networks.
Audit system performance for unusual patterns.
Establish an disaster recovery plan to address potential breaches.
A thorough cybersecurity posture for BMS is no longer optional—it's a essential practice for modern building owners and building administrators.
